New version format: * for releases, `x.y.z` (follows tag without leading `v`) * for nightly builds, `x.y.z+N+hash` (previous version, not the upcoming one) This means that each nightly build `aptly` would report correct version now. Version is now complied into the aptly binary, system tests automatically check for current version, no need to update them anymore.
